    What are the advantages and disadvantages of horizontal integration?

    July 9, 2024 No Comments

    A: A company that seeks to expand through a horizontal integration can achieve economies of scale, economies of scope, increased market power or market share, reduction of production costs, reduction of competition and increases in other synergies.     What are the advantages and disadvantages of zero-based budgeting in accounting?

    July 9, 2024 No Comments

    A: The major advantages of zero-based budgeting are flexible budgets, focused operations, lower costs and more disciplined execution, while the disadvantages are resource intensiveness, the possibility of being manipulated by savvy managers and a bias towards short-term planning.
